• Our Arklahoma Heritage: A "general physician" from Dyer was signing death certificates a few weeks before the flu took him (todayinfortsmith.com) — Dyer’s early 1900s doctor, Joseph H. Ayers, cared for local farm and railroad families right up until the 1918 flu pandemic claimed his own life. Records show he treated patients in and around Dyer, raised a family there with his wife Gussie, and is buried in Dyer Cemetery, tying his story closely to the town’s roots.
